Nasdaq Inc - Ordinary Shares - 144A (NDAQ) Q2 Earnings call transcript Jul 25, 2024

In its recent earnings call, Nasdaq revealed a strong second-quarter performance, underscoring its resilience and ability to navigate economic challenges. The company, led by Adena Friedman, Chair and CEO, reported a solid financial picture, highlighting its diversified business model and strategic initiatives.

Economic Environment and Market Activity

Nasdaq's second-quarter performance was set against a backdrop of a solid but slowing U.S. economy, with cooling inflation and slightly rising unemployment. Despite external uncertainties, the company anticipates modestly improving IPO activity for the remainder of 2024, with a healthy European pipeline for 2025. The company's markets continue to experience robust trading activity and strong demand for mission-critical technology solutions, indicating a healthy backdrop for continued revenue growth.

Financial Performance

Nasdaq reported a net revenue of $1.2 billion, a 10% increase year-over-year, with Solutions revenues at 13% growth. The company's overall annualized recurring revenue (ARR) grew 7% to $2.7 billion, reflecting the power and resilience of its diversified business model. Notably, the company's expenses increased 7% year-over-year, within guidance, and operating income grew approximately 14%, with an operating margin of 53%.

Strategic Priorities and Business Highlights

Nasdaq's strategic priorities of integrate, innovate, and accelerate are clearly evident in its operations. The company has made significant strides in integrating its acquisitions, with the Addenda acquisition ahead of schedule and the investment thesis already demonstrating value for clients, shareholders, and employees. The company's innovation efforts, particularly in AI technologies, are driving productivity and enhancing its product offerings. The integration of Calypso and AxiomSL is also progressing well, with a strong sales pipeline and a focus on maintaining a One Nasdaq go-to-market approach.
